Q: Is 159,890 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 159,890 is not a prime number.

Why is 159,890 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 159890 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 59 118 271 295 542 590 1,355 2,710 15,989 31,978 79,945 and 159,890, with no remainder.

Since 159,890 cannot be divided by just 1 and 159,890, it is not a prime number.
